Abstract
The invention belongs to the field of renewable energy resources and relates to a novel wave energy power generation device which can collect wave energy and convert the wave energy into ocean currents in a pipeline so as to generate power by driving a turbine through the ocean currents. The turbine is directly placed in a water channel, and blades are driven to rotate through kinetic energy of sea water. The pitch angle can be automatically changed by the blades of the turbine so as to adapt to changes of the direction of the ocean currents in the pipeline, and therefore the starting performance of the turbine is improved, and the rotating direction of the turbine is not changed. The device is easy to construct, a power generator does not make contact with sea water, and the reliability is high; the shrinking water channel is used for collecting the wave energy and converting the wave energy into reciprocating ocean current energy in the vertical water channel; the power generator is directly driven through the passive self-pitch-changing turbine; the reliability and the converting efficiency are effectively improved; due to the fact that the power generator is placed on the shore and does not make contact with sea water, the power generator is convenient to maintain, and operating cost is reduced.

Background technology
The energy is the necessary requirement that the mankind depend on for existence and development, and the allowable exploitation of fossil energy gradually decreases, and the mankind can only Looking For Substitutions Of Oil.Wherein wave energy content is huge, has considerable DEVELOPMENT PROSPECT, but the exploitation of wave energy is still within conceptual phase, it is impossible to meet business-like requirement.Although the scientific and technological demonstrative project having wave energy in recent years is implemented, but technology immature, it is impossible to promote on a large scale.Oscillating water column wave power conversion technology is a kind of important wave energy development scheme, and it is the reciprocating motion of air the convert reciprocating motion of wave, promotes wheel rotation by the air stream of compression.This technology mostly uses air Wells turbine as wave energy converter, and this turbine is a kind of aerodynamic turbine, and energy could need to be utilized by turbine through two times transfer, and conversion efficiency is low.It is contemplated that propose a kind of brand-new wave-energy power generation mode.

Technical scheme:
Electromotor is arranged on the bank, do not contact sea water, it is to avoid the corrosion of sea water.Turbine is placed directly within water channel, utilizes the kinetic energy of sea water to drive blade to rotate.Turbine blade can change propeller pitch angle automatically, and the change of current direction in adaptation pipeline, thus improves the startability of turbine and direction of rotation is constant.
It is broadening formation that water channel is shunk on bank, and opening part is oval and be circular at turbine, and both have the biggest area ratio, and the water velocity at turbine is opening part several times.Wave pours in water channel from opening part, by the reciprocal ocean current being converted in vertical water channel after shrinking water channel.In order to prevent ratchel under extreme climate to be washed into water channel, water channel opening part to seabed keeps a segment distance and is vertical cross section.The bottom shrinking water channel is downward-sloping, which reduces the chance that silt is attached in water channel.
Turbine is placed in the centre position of water-head in vertical water channel, is connected by main shaft with generator amature.Vertical water channel top is fillet, so can ensure that ventilation road is smooth and easy, reduces ventilation noise.Ventilation road can ensure that vertical water channel is connected with outside atmosphere, it is to avoid affects the peak level of vertical water channel due to air compression when wave pours in vertical water channel.Electromotor is fixed on bank, utilizes straddle truck it to be sling together with turbine when needing repairing.Maintenance is carried out on bank, does not contact sea water, which decreases cost and the difficulty of maintenance.

Detailed description of the invention
Electromotor 2 is connected with straddle truck 1 by side arm 3 on the bank.Motor 2 is fixed on bank, and when needing repairing, motor 2 can be mentioned by straddle truck 1, and turbine 6 is left the water.Motor 2 is connected by main shaft 4 with turbine 6, and main shaft is spacing by the side arm in water channel and bearing 5.Wave pours in contraction water channel 8 by the big mouth 12 of broadening formation, and in vertical water channel 9, water surface extreme higher position is 11.Big mouth 12 is oval, and osculum is circular.It is presented herein below to break outside big mouth 12 and faces A directly, be possible to prevent ratchel to be washed into contraction water channel 8.The bottom B shrinking water channel 8 is downward-sloping, and the silt so entering contraction water channel 8 can slowly reflux, and prevents silt to be attached to shrink in water channel 8.After current enter vertical water channel 9, blade 7 adjusts propeller pitch angle automatically, starts to rotate.After startup, turbine carries out high speed rotating, has the highest energy conversion efficiency.When in water channel, the water surface declines, blade 7 reversely adjusts angle, direction of rotation and current and enters during water channel consistent.Water channel blow-by, is taken a breath with the external world by ventilation road 10.
